首页
学习
活动
专区
圈层
工具
发布
    • 综合排序
    • 最热优先
    • 最新优先
    时间不限
  • 来自专栏PbootCMS开发

    PbootCMS二次开发常见问题(2)

    在进行PbootCMS二次开发时,会碰到一些问题。下面我梳理一些问题及其解决方法,以供参考。注意:实际开发请根据具体环境和需求进行调整。建议在开发前备份原有文件和数据,以免造成不必要的损失。 留言板功能二次开发留言板是常见的互动功能,其二次开发主要集中在Ajax提交和分页显示。实现Ajax无刷新提交:为了提升用户体验,我们常希望留言提交后页面不刷新。

    28610编辑于 2025-09-24
  • 来自专栏.NET企业级解决方案应用与咨询

    C#开发BIMFACE系列2 二次开发流程

    注册成功后,使用注册账号登录系统,打开“控制台”界面,提供了一个AppKey 与 AppSecret,用于二次开发调用API接口时使用。使用原理与调用微信API接口大致相同。 ? 由于服务器端的API都是RESTful 风格,所以可以使用PHP、Java、.NET等进行二次开发。模型转换完成后,使用 Javascript API 在网页中实现模型的浏览及其他的集成开发。 ? 转换引擎 职责:解析原始文件格式,生成BIMFACE的数据包; 2. BIM数据存储引擎 职责:存储海量异构的BIM数据,并提供便捷快速的查询接口; 3. 显示引擎 职责:通过浏览器显示模型或图纸。

    90950发布于 2019-09-18
  • 来自专栏Revit二次开发

    Revit二次开发——创建墙体(2)(第十一期)

    上一期我们学了一下最简单的墙体创建的代码,这期我们来学复杂的墙体创建,我们学习二次开发的原因就是要辅助设计提高效率,翻模的话能够插件自动翻模,因此我们的墙体不可能会是默认墙体那么简单,需要有各种不同的尺寸 2. 精讲Revit二次开发,望与君交。 ----

    80250编辑于 2022-04-21
  • 来自专栏全栈程序员必看

    revit二次开发教程_BIM二次开发

    1、利用revit 2012和vs 2010实现二次开发。 1) 第一步,利用vs2010建立c# Windows服务类型的项目。 2) 给新生成的项目添加引用,(放在工程上右键),添加revit相关,把revitAPI.dll和rivitAPIUI.dll加入。

    2.3K10编辑于 2022-09-19
  • 来自专栏后端开发专栏

    CATIA二次开发VBA入门——一些代码合集(2

    引出简介:CATIA二次开发VBA入门——一些代码合集本篇博客文章分享一些CATIA vba基础相关的代码,包括定义创建body的方法,根据名字找body,取消激活,加厚,获取文件路径,自定义属性的设置 As ThicknessSet thickness2 = shapes1.Item("厚度.1")Set offset1 = thickness2.OffsetMsgBox offset1.ValueEnd To Npart1.InWorkObject = body1Dim body2 As BodySet body2 = Bodies1.Item(2)'MsgBox body2.Name'~ MsgBox body2.NameDim assemble1 As AssembleSet assemble1 = shapeFactory1.AddNewAssemble(body2)part1.UpdateObject 255, 255, 0, 0Obj.SetRealLineType 4, 0'Obj.SetShow catVisPropertyNoShowAttrpart1.UpdateEnd Sub总结CATIA二次开发

    1.6K00编辑于 2025-01-25
  • 来自专栏鸿鹄实验室

    CobaltStrike二次开发

    2、CobaltStrike特征修改 1、修改stager防止被扫:修改位置如下: cloudstrike/webserver.class ? 主要是isStager函数,只要不是92或者93就行。 static byte[] beacon_obfuscate(byte[] var0) { byte[] var1 = new byte[var0.length]; for(int var2 = 0; var2 < var0.length; ++var2) { var1[var2] = (byte)(var0[var2] ^ ); } return var1; } 2、修改源码。简单免杀: shellcode生成的路径为: /aggressor/dialogs/PayloadGeneratorDialog.java ? __biz=MzU2NTc2MjAyNg==&mid=2247484689&idx=1&sn=8cf9c031f3d926c155ee5c018941b416&chksm=fcb78794cbc00e82e7a44f89e796be2ef551a792946992dd540d31891848dca84398de16b85e

    3K30发布于 2021-04-01
  • 来自专栏测试开发架构之路

    jmeter二次开发

    1.下载源码 http://jmeter.apache.org/download_jmeter.cgi 2.修改文件名 eclipse.classpath和eclipse.project ren . clinit>(NewDriver.java:101) ERROR StatusLogger Unable to access file:/D:/1openSourceWorksapce/bin/log4j2. xml java.io.FileNotFoundException: D:\1openSourceWorksapce\bin\log4j2.xml (系统找不到指定的路径。)

    2.4K10发布于 2018-09-28
  • 来自专栏渗透云笔记

    二次开发CobaltStrike

    关于二次开发后的CobaltStrike 默认的CobaltStrike内存在多处流量特征,在马儿与服务端建立连接时进行流量交互.此间存在多处可疑特征已被各大杀软记录在册 如:卡巴斯基,诺顿,迈克菲等 所以在客户端进行免杀的同时服务端在流量交互方面也需要特征去除,才产生了二次开发后CobaltStrike. 此次二开为CobaltStrike4.1版本. 效果截图 ? 迈克菲截图 ? 2.将cobaltstrike.jar文件替换客户端的原有jar ? 3.请确保服务端或客户端的Java环境在Jdk10以上(包含JDK10) 修改特征处 1.修改默认DefaultProfile文件 2.修改checksum()函数 3.修改反射处dll名称 求

    2K20发布于 2021-04-26
  • 来自专栏全栈程序员必看

    discuz 二次开发

    2、discuz 运行流程 比如:本地服务器主机文件夹找到刚刚移进去的 discuz 文件夹(没改名的话就是 upload), 打开 home.php 文件 require_once libfile(

    2.4K11编辑于 2022-08-31
  • 来自专栏全栈程序员必看

    arcgis二次开发python-ArcGIS 二次开发专题 序「建议收藏」

    依据ArcGIS 组件式开发及应用的目录结构,将系统性的学习ArcGIS 二次开发的道路分为三个部分。这个系列包含以下三个部分: Part1 基础 1. 前言 1.1 组件式GIS 1.2 ArcObject 开发的特点与历史 2. 使用ArcGIS Engine控件编程 3. 几何形体对象 Geometry 4. 地图组成 5. 基于Python脚本的二次开发 Part2 常见的应用 1. 矢量、删格数据的空间分析 2. 管网几何、交通网络分析 3. 城市规划专题 4. 智能小区、物业、物流系统专题 5. 从而让自己在GIS 二次开发领域能够自由发挥想象力,解决更多的社会问题,给每个人带来更多的便利,让每个好人的人生更加绚丽多彩! WENG LIU 2016-9-18 2154 参考书籍: 1. ArcGIS Engine组件式开发及应用 2. ArcGIS Engine地理信息系统开发教程 3. ARCGIS10从初学到精通 4.

    2.4K11编辑于 2022-09-15
  • 来自专栏TBDS & AI

    kubeflow二次开发项目

    背景 Datainsight 是基于kubeflow二次开发的项目。是一个专用于k8s上具备可移植性与可扩展性的机器学习工具包。 Pasted Graphic 5.png 整体可以将pipeline主要划分为8个部分: 1、python sdk:notebook katib 把代码生成pipelines组件的特定语言(DSL) 22、根据定义好的组件组成流水线,在流水线中,由输入/输出关系会确定图上的边以及方向。在定义好流水线后,可以通过python中实现好的流水线客户端提交到系统中运行。 2、phthon SDK负责构造出刘姝贤,并且根据流水线构造出ScheduledWorkflow的yaml定义,随后将其作为参数传递给流水线系统的后端服务。 此外,KFServer是在 KServe 中使用预测 v1 协议实现的 Python 模型服务运行时, MLServer使用 REST 和 gRPC实现了预测 v2 协议。

    4.8K61编辑于 2021-12-09
  • 来自专栏全栈程序员必看

    ArcGIS二次开发前言

    ArcGIS二次开发前言 前言 环境 常见bug解决方案 前言 自毕业成为GIS开发工程师已有一年多的时间,时间很短,短到不过人一生中工作时限的3.75%,时间很长,长到收藏夹已经从零攒到了一千四百多条记录 (2)ArcGIS arcgis的开发主要包括AO(ArcObject)和AE(ArcEngine)两种模式。 二者主要有以下几点区别: 1.开发环境 AO须要安装ArcGIS Desktop和ArcObjects,AE只须要安装ArcEngine Runtime和Develop Kit(SDK)即可; 2. 2. “互操作类型”实际是指一系列Com组件的程序集,是公共运行库中库文件,类似于编译好的类,接口等。 3. 首先排查控件是否注册成功,若控件注册成功且依然报错,在64位系统中,可以试试项目右键——属性——生成——常规——目标平台改为x86,这通常是第三方COM组件只支持32位引起的,这在低版本的arcgis二次开发中经常会遇到

    1.2K10编辑于 2022-09-07
  • 来自专栏Solidworks二次开发

    SolidWorks二次开发简介

    对于一些特定的需求,二次开发可以帮助扩展SOLIDWORKS的功能,定制化解决方案。二次开发可以通过编程语言或API(应用程序接口)来实现,让用户自定义功能、工具或者流程,以满足特定的设计需求。 如果您需要在SOLIDWORKS中实现特定功能,可以考虑进行二次开发,或者寻求相关开发服务的支持。1. 什么是 SolidWorks 的二次开发? 这种二次开发的方法可以提高工作效率,加快设计过程,并满足个性化的需求。如果用户具有一定的编程知识和技能,就可以利用SOLIDWORKS的API进行二次开发,或者借助专业开发人员来实现特定定制化需求。 2. 对 SolidWorks 进行二次开发需要学习哪些基础知识?2.为什么要进行二次开发? a. 批量作业软件:通过二次开发,将一些批量作业交给程序来完成,比如批量写属性、批量转格式。​​更多学习内容,可关注公众号:CAD软件二次开发以上内容为个人测试过程的记录,供大家参考。

    72710编辑于 2024-07-24
  • 来自专栏全栈程序员必看

    autocad二次开发资料总结

    我们可以根据他灵活的开放性对其进行二次开发定制,让它更加适用于某一具体的设计领域。 为什么要对AutoCAD进行二次开发 AutoCAD是目前在Windows和MAC系统中应用最为广泛、使用人数最多的CAD软件。 2. 稳定性:运行稳定性反映出因程序可能出现的严重错误所导致的危险。 这个Kean在其文章中也提到了希望引入Paper.js及leap.js等有趣的2d图形库。 而本人也通过尝试d3.js库了解了利用网络库编程的优点,因此,如box2d、Processing.js、Raphaël、Math.js等图形库和物理引擎库等。

    4K32编辑于 2022-11-01
  • 来自专栏T客来了

    AE 二次开发小结

    章节 ae 软件基本介绍 ae 软件基本介绍 掌握n个基本概念 ae script 基本概念学习 ae script 常用操作 ae script 二次开发 开发者论坛 关于突破认知,学习新知识的方法论 1. ae 软件基本介绍 要进行基于 ae script 的二次开发,首先要储备一些基础理论或概念。 看完前几个就算是入门了,基本理解到以下程度: 了解一个项目的构建方式 理解ae素材的组织逻辑 可以新建一个合成 composition 可以在一个composition 中拖入若干个layer 了解 tools 工具栏 2. 4. ae script 二次开发 开发者论坛 得吐槽一下,某度现在根据关键字搜索到的有价值信息完全不够,而且良莠不齐,简易还是使用Google。 二次开发论坛: https://forums.creativecow.net http://www.aenhancers.com ae 二次开发 开发者论坛,上面可以找到一些问题的解决方案; 5.

    1.4K10发布于 2020-04-08
  • 来自专栏全栈程序员必看

    php二次开发知识,Discuz二次开发基本知识详细讲解

    Discuz是国内最流行的论坛软件管理系统,今天小编跟大家分享一篇关于Discuz二次开发基本知识详细讲解,感兴趣的朋友跟小编一起来了解一下吧! 一) Discuz! 均需要注册到admincp.php文件,每个功能都至少有一个或一个以上的Action(动作),在admincp.php中,可以定义Action的执行权限,分别为:“admin==1”管理员,或“admin==2 七) DZ如何处理用户信息(存取、计算、更新过程) 新手要做二次开发,都必须掌握这数组中,每个数组元素的意义。 a) DZ的基本信息,如用户信息,Session信息存在如下变量中: a). 2)从数据读取相应的数据。 3)数据在写入缓存前作相应处理。 4)最后写入缓存。 security.inc.php 安全 sendmail.inc.php 邮件 serverbusy.htm 系统繁忙 template.func.php 模板 threadpay.inc.php 购买帖子 以上就是Discuz二次开发基本知识详细讲解

    5.6K20编辑于 2022-08-26
  • 来自专栏全栈程序员必看

    php二次开发知识,Discuz!二次开发基本知识「建议收藏」

    必须至少具备如下技能: 1) 能够理很好理解MVC构架的原理(虽然DZ不是MVC架构的) 2) 扎实的PHP基础,熟悉结构化程序,OOP程序的写法及应用 3) 熟悉MYSQL就用,掌握SQL语言,懂SQL 均需要注册到admincp.php文件,每个功能都至少有一个或一个以上的Action(动作),在admincp.php中,可以定义Action的执行权限,分别为:“admin==1”管理员,或“admin==2 七) DZ如何处理用户信息(存取、计算、更新过程) 新手要做二次开发,都必须掌握这数组中,每个数组元素的意义。 a) DZ的基本信息,如用户信息,Session信息存在如下变量中: a). 2)从数据读取相应的数据。 3)数据在写入缓存前作相应处理。 4)最后写入缓存。

    3.6K21编辑于 2022-08-30
  • 来自专栏程序IT圈

    基于SpringBoot2+Vue+Redis的聚合支付系统,可二次开发接私活!

    项目特点 支持多渠道对接,支付网关自动路由 已对接微信服务商和普通商户接口,支持V2和V3接口 已对接支付宝服务商和普通商户接口,支持RSA和RSA2签名 已对接云闪付服务商接口,可选择多家支付机构 提供 管理平台操作界面简洁、易用 支付平台到商户系统的订单通知使用MQ实现,保证了高可用,消息可达 支付渠道的接口参数配置界面自动化生成 使用spring security实现权限管理 前后端分离架构,方便二次开发

    76560编辑于 2022-03-09
  • 来自专栏全栈程序员必看

    二次开发mysql数据反推_Discuz二次开发之数据库操作

    sql为查询语句,$arg为绑定参数 例:$result = DB::fetch_all(‘SELECT * FROM %t’,array(‘table_name’)); $result为二维数组 2

    62010编辑于 2022-08-31
  • 来自专栏编程微刊

    网站二次开发的总结

    半个多月的时间,完成了网站的二次开发,其中,存在太多的问题,还是比较心烦的 (一)首先就说我自己做的工作吧,自己在工作中做了什么,其实我的工作量很大的,logo的设计,文字排版,图片抠图问题等等,一时没有想到就不一一罗列了 2.文字问题,本来是文字有专门的人来负责,他也只是负责帮忙找一大段的素材而已,还得靠自己去提炼素材里面的精华 3.排版问题,在排版这一块是完全没有思路的 4.代码问题,用word press后台模板来开发的 两方面的原因加上一个公司网速的原因 1.所有的东西都是我一个人在弄,我本身就没有多少设计感,只能去别人的网站上模仿,找来别人的图,进行修改,增加创意,毕竟,凭空创造出一个东西来,现阶段的我还是做不到的 2. 1.视频如何铺满整个父级的div 2.案例页面鼠标滑动导航条出现灰色的背景 3.字体如何居中 4.图片过多,如何进行优化 (五)我的几点建议,对自己,对公司 1. 在文字上,把那些要改的都标记出来,然后整理成一份word文档给我,要是分段改结构,我没有那么多咬文爵字的经历,需要你总结出来给我,我再添加上去,岂不是效率更高 2.规范问题、时间节点问题,相互协调问题,

    1.4K60发布于 2018-05-31
领券